The ingredients needed to make Sour Spicy Beef Soup (Asem Asem Daging):
Get 500 gr beef cube/shank, cut cubed
Make ready 2 liters water
Get 200 gr french beans, cut like a matchstick
Prepare 1 big carrot, cut like a matchstick
Make ready 2 green/unripe green tomatoes
Make ready 1/4 tsp pepper
Prepare 1 tbsp sweet soya sauce (preferably Indonesian sweet soya sauce like bango or ABC brand)
Take 1 piece gula melaka/brown sugar (about 50 gram)
Make ready 4 tsp tamarind juice
Take to taste Salt, sugar
Make ready Stir Fry Ingredients
Get 4 big green chillies, cut
Take 1 big red chillies, cut
Prepare 6 bird eye chillies/chilli padi, whole - no need to cut
Take 6 shallots, slice thinly
Take 3 garlics, slice thinly
Get 4 cm galangal/blue ginger, cut and smashed a bit to release the flavour
Make ready 3 pcs Indonesian bay leaves
Prepare Oil

Every region in Indonesia has its own asem-asem and is very proud of it. It can be totally vegan or very non-vegan.
Instructions to make Sour Spicy Beef Soup (Asem Asem Daging):
Clean, cut the beef cube or shank. Put in pressure cooker, add 2 litres of water and cook for 15-30 mins (beef shank 15 mins, beef cube 30 mins). Set aside.
Prepare the rest of the ingredients, wash clean and cut accordingly
Heat some oil in a frying pan, stir fry the shallot and garlic until fragrant and turn translucent. Add chillies, bay leaves, galangal. Continue cooking for few more minutes.
Add the stir fried chillies/shallots/garlics to the beef soup. Turn on the fire again, add sweet soya sauce, brown sugar, salt, pepper, sugar. Add french beans and carrot, cook until soften. Lastly add the green tomatoes and tamarind juice. Cook for a few more minutes. I don’t cook the tomatoes until too soft/mushy.
Taste, add any seasoning as needed. The soup will be a mixture of sour, spicy, sweet and salty at the same time. So refreshing
Serve with warm rice 😋😋
For me: at step 4, once I cook the shallots/garlics/chillies in the soup for a few minutes, I will take the chillies out from the soup and put them in separate bowl. Why? Because the longer you cook the chillies, the spicier your soup will be. And as I am cooking for the whole family, I don’t want the soup to be too spicy for my kids. We will add the chillies back before serving in our individual bowl.
